TRIVIA:
- Is a fan of science fiction author Philip K. Dick.
- Raised in Los Angeles.
- Turned down the opportunity to direct _Who Framed Roger Rabbit (1988)_ (qv), _Enemy Mine (1985)_ (qv), and _Forrest Gump (1994)_ (qv) and _Alien: Resurrection (1997)_ (qv).
- 'J.K. Rowling' (qv), creator of the "Harry Potter" book series, originally wanted Gilliam to direct _Harry Potter and the Sorcerer's Stone (2001)_ (qv), but Warner Brothers studios wanted a more family friendly film and eventually settled for 'Chris Columbus' (qv).
- He did not originally intend to cast 'Sean Connery' (qv) as King Agamemnon in _Time Bandits (1981)_ (qv), he merely wrote in the screenplay that when Agamemnon took off his helmet that he looked "exactly like Sean Connery." To Gilliam's surprise, the script found its way into Connery's hands and Connery subsequently expressed interest in doing the film.
- Gave up his US citizenship in January 2006. [source: Haaretz interview, Feb. 2006].
- Has been off and on to write and direct a movie adaptation of 'Alan Moore (III)' (qv) and 'Dave Gibbons' (qv)'s graphic novel "Watchmen." Gilliam has said he attempted to write an accurate screenplay but it would be unfilmable, but he would consider directing it if it were made into 10 or 12-part cable television series.
- Founding editor of and principal contributor to campus humor magazine, "Fang", at Occidental College in Los Angeles, CA in the early 1960s.
